Nashville — 58 nights

Music City U.S.A.
Known as the capital of country music, the thriving city of Nashville combines old-world southern charm with a progressive urban flair.You'll find plenty of places to visit near Nashville: Franklin (McLemore House, Franklin Farmers Market, &more), Mammoth Cave National Park (Echo River, Mammoth Cave, &more) and Dueling Grounds Distillery (in Franklin). There's still lots to do: contemplate the long history of Belle Meade Historic Site & Winery, get engrossed in the history at Lotz House Museum, see the interesting displays at Andrew Jackson's Hermitage, and admire the landmark architecture of Nashville Parthenon.
